What are dental implants and dental implantation?

Dental implants are a professional replacement for a tooth root, most often made from a specific category of titanium alloy that bonds and integrates with bone best. Dental implantation is a process during which a tooth-root-shaped titanium alloy screw (implant) is inserted into the jawbone, and a dental prosthesis is fixed onto it. With proper care, implants are long-lasting and can serve for a lifetime.

Do dental implants harm neighbouring teeth?

A dental implant is a small titanium screw that replaces a lost tooth root and can be restored with fixed or removable prostheses. Dental implants in Vilnius, as in other cities, help restore missing teeth without grinding down or placing load on neighbouring teeth. Dental implantation helps even in cases where all teeth have been lost.

What should those who choose dental implantation prepare for?

Dental implantation consists of several stages:

1. Consultation

During the consultation, the doctor evaluates the general condition of the mouth and jawbone. The doctor also prepares an accurate treatment plan—deciding how many implants will be needed, what type they will be, in which areas, and which structural elements will be used. During the consultation, the doctor discusses the advantages and disadvantages of implantation, as well as alternative treatment options, with the patient.

2. Surgical stage

When placing one implant, the surgery takes only 30 minutes. If more implants are placed at the same time or additional procedures are performed, the surgery takes longer—1–2 hours. When dental implants are placed in Vilnius, as in other cities, local anaesthesia is usually used during surgery. However, at the patient’s request or during longer procedures, intravenous anaesthesia (sedation) is also possible. During sedation, the patient relaxes more and experiences less fear. After surgery, the patient must follow a certain regimen—keep sterile gauze clenched in the mouth for some time, avoid eating, avoid physical exertion, cold exposure, overheating, take antibiotics prescribed by the doctor and, if necessary, painkillers.

Swelling may occur after the procedure. Therefore, the operated area should be cooled immediately. One or two days after surgery, the patient must visit the doctor for an examination. If body temperature rises suddenly, significant swelling occurs, severe pain develops, numbness appears in the operated area, or any other questions arise, it is necessary to contact your dentist immediately—the dentist who placed your dental implants in Vilnius, at “Ozo” clinic.

Sutures are removed after 7–10 days. Then it is necessary to wait until the implant successfully integrates with bone and becomes fixed in the jaw. The waiting period may last up to half a year. Only once the implant has successfully integrated with bone can the next stage—prosthetic restoration—begin.

When does a sinus floor elevation procedure become unavoidable?

After the loss of upper molars, the maxillary sinuses also remodel. They descend downward, which reduces bone height. At first, the bone height may still be sufficient for implant placement, but over time it may decrease rapidly. Then sinus lift surgery becomes unavoidable. A painless sinus floor elevation procedure lasting approximately one and a half hours helps ensure a safe site for implants.

How does immediate implantation differ from delayed implantation?

During immediate implantation, dental implants in Vilnius, as elsewhere, are inserted immediately into the socket of a freshly extracted tooth, which is why immediate implantation is often called “fast implantation”. By choosing immediate implantation, treatment time is shortened by several months. In this case, prosthetic restoration on the implant is performed approximately after 3–6 months, once the implant integrates into the bone.

However, immediate implantation is not always possible. Sometimes, due to the patient’s health, the condition of the oral cavity, gums, and jaw, implantation has to be postponed for several months after tooth extraction.

When is a bone augmentation procedure needed?

After tooth loss, the upper and lower jaws atrophy. Over time, the bone deteriorates and becomes insufficient for placing a dental implant. In such cases, a bone augmentation procedure is required.

During bone augmentation, the patient’s own bone (allogeneic) or an artificial bone substitute (xenogeneic) is added where bone is lacking. The surgery can be performed in any area of the jaw. Four to six months after augmentation surgery, the bone integrates, and dental implantation can then be performed. Its success directly depends on the jawbone surrounding the implant.

Bone augmentation can also help in the treatment of periodontal diseases. Replacing damaged bone tissue helps protect neighbouring teeth and provides them with better support.
